Neighborhood sewer improvement projects

This is a list of sanitary sewer work anticipated between September 11 and 15.  The estimated duration of the work is included.

  • Woodland, 3rd  Council District, 1 Week (Dig and Replace) (Lane Closure)
  • Ransom, 3rd Council District, 1 Week (Dig and Replace) (Lane Closure)
  • Carlisle, 1st   Council District, 3 Months 2 Weeks (Dig and Replace) (Street Closure)
  • New Orleans, 6th Council District, 3 Days (Not in Street)
  • Little Pigeon Court, 8th  Council District, 1 Day (Manhole Rehab)
  • Woodmont, 5th  Council District, 1 Day(Manhole Rehab)
  • The Woods, 5th Council District, 2 Days (Manhole Rehab)
